Antari S-600 Snow Machine, 600W

The Antari S-600 is a gas-powered snow machine designed for stage and event use, capable of projecting artificial snow up to 60 feet with a clearing width also around 60 feet, which means it can cover a fairly large area with snow effects. It produces an ideal snow depth of about 20 meters, suggesting it can create a visually impactful snow scene for performances or parties. The 600W power rating indicates it has a decent output level, suitable for medium to large venues.

Weighing 66 pounds, it is somewhat heavy and less portable compared to lighter models, and might require sturdy mounting or a strong support system. Being gas-powered, it may produce some noise and require ventilation, which is a consideration for indoor use. The Antari S-600 serves as a strong choice if you need a powerful snow machine with wide coverage and significant throw distance, though it may be less suitable if you require a lightweight or quieter machine.

The Antari S-500 Silent Snow Machine is designed for creating realistic snow effects on stage and at events. It features a large 20-liter fluid tank and a maximum fluid flow rate of 400 ml per minute, enabling a steady stream of snowflakes suitable for longer performances. The machine weighs 93 pounds and measures about 29 inches in each dimension, so adequate space and sturdy mounting options should be considered due to its size and weight.

The machine is equipped with a powerful 890-watt motor that can effectively cover medium to large stage areas. Controls include a user-friendly LCD panel and DMX compatibility, allowing for easy integration with lighting and effects systems. Its quiet operation aligns with the “Silent” branding, making it appropriate for events where minimal sound disruption is desired.

This snow machine is well-suited for stage productions and events that require consistent, quiet snow effects with good coverage, especially when there is sufficient space and setup time available to accommodate its bulkier size.

Antari S-500DXL Silent Snow Machine

The Antari S-500DXL Silent Snow Machine is designed for stage and event use where quiet operation is important, featuring very silent performance when the road case is closed. It includes a 65.6-foot air hose and nozzle, which helps distribute snow over a decent area, making it suitable for medium-sized stage setups. Wireless DMX control and an S-3 wired remote provide flexible control options, and the included PM-1 pan motor allows for directional snow coverage.

The machine is quite heavy at 120 pounds, so it may require sturdy support or dedicated mounting equipment. This model is well suited for users needing a quieter snow effect with remote control capabilities, while those looking for lighter equipment might want to consider other options.

Buying Guide for the Best Stage Snow Machines

Choosing the right stage snow machine can greatly enhance the atmosphere of your event, whether it's a theatrical production, a concert, or a holiday celebration. The key to selecting the best snow machine for your needs is understanding the various specifications and how they align with your specific requirements. Here are the key specs to consider and how to navigate them to make an informed decision.
Snow OutputSnow output refers to the amount of artificial snow a machine can produce, usually measured in cubic feet per minute (CFM). This spec is important because it determines how much snow will be generated and how quickly it will cover the desired area. Low output machines (under 500 CFM) are suitable for small indoor spaces or intimate settings. Medium output machines (500-1000 CFM) are ideal for larger indoor venues or small outdoor areas. High output machines (over 1000 CFM) are best for large outdoor events or stages that require a significant snow effect. Consider the size of your venue and the desired intensity of the snow effect when choosing the right output level.
Coverage AreaCoverage area indicates the maximum area that the snow machine can effectively cover with snow. This is typically measured in square feet. A small coverage area (up to 500 sq ft) is suitable for small stages or specific sections of a larger stage. Medium coverage (500-1500 sq ft) works well for mid-sized stages or larger sections. Large coverage areas (over 1500 sq ft) are necessary for extensive stages or outdoor events. Assess the size of your stage or event space to determine the appropriate coverage area for your needs.
Snowflake SizeSnowflake size refers to the size of the artificial snow particles produced by the machine. This can range from fine, powdery snow to larger, more visible flakes. Fine snow is ideal for creating a subtle, realistic snowfall effect, while larger flakes are more visible and can create a more dramatic effect. Consider the type of event and the desired visual impact when selecting the snowflake size. For a realistic winter scene, finer snow is preferable, whereas for a festive or theatrical effect, larger flakes may be more suitable.
Noise LevelNoise level is the amount of sound produced by the snow machine during operation, usually measured in decibels (dB). This is important because a noisy machine can be distracting or disruptive, especially in quiet or intimate settings. Low noise machines (under 60 dB) are ideal for indoor events or performances where minimal disruption is crucial. Medium noise machines (60-80 dB) are suitable for larger venues where some background noise is acceptable. High noise machines (over 80 dB) are best for outdoor events or loud environments where the noise will not be as noticeable. Consider the setting and the importance of maintaining a quiet atmosphere when choosing the noise level.
Fluid ConsumptionFluid consumption refers to the amount of snow fluid the machine uses to produce snow, typically measured in liters per hour. This spec is important because it affects the operating cost and the frequency of refilling the machine. Low consumption machines (under 1 liter per hour) are cost-effective and require less frequent refilling, making them suitable for smaller events or short-duration use. Medium consumption machines (1-2 liters per hour) are ideal for mid-sized events or moderate-duration use. High consumption machines (over 2 liters per hour) are best for large events or long-duration use where a continuous snow effect is needed. Consider the duration of your event and the budget for operating costs when selecting the fluid consumption rate.
Mounting OptionsMounting options refer to the ways in which the snow machine can be installed or positioned, such as floor-standing, wall-mounted, or truss-mounted. This is important because it affects the flexibility and ease of setup. Floor-standing machines are easy to move and set up, making them suitable for temporary or mobile setups. Wall-mounted machines save floor space and are ideal for permanent installations. Truss-mounted machines can be positioned at various heights and angles, providing greater flexibility for larger stages or complex setups. Consider the layout of your venue and the ease of installation when choosing the mounting options.
